FEATURES
• Access Times: 12, 15, 20, 25, 35, 45, 55, 70, & 100ns
• Battery Backup: 2V data retention
• Low power standby
• High-performance, low-power CMOS double-metal process
• Single +5V (+10%) Power Supply
• Easy memory expansion with CE\
• All inputs and outputs are TTL compatible

GENERAL DESCRIPTION
The Austin Semiconductor SRAM family employs
high-speed, low power CMOS designs using a four-transistor
memory cell. These SRAMs are fabricated using double-layer
metal, double-layer polysilicon technology.
For flexibility in high-speed memory applications,
Austin Semiconductor offers chip enable (CE\) and output
enable (OE\) capability. These enhancements can place the
outputs in High-Z for additional flexibility in system design.
Writing to these devices is accomplished when write
enable (WE\) and CE\ inputs are both LOW. Reading is
accomplished when WE\ remains HIGH and CE\ and OE\ go
LOW. The device offers a reduced power standby mode when
disabled. This allows system designs to achieve low standby
power requirements.
The “L” version provides a battery backup/low
voltage data retention mode, offering 2mW maximum power
dissipation at 2 volts. All devices operate from a single +5V
power supply and all inputs and outputs are fully TTL
compatible.
